What is the Certificate IV in dental Assisting?
the Certificate IV in Dental Assisting (qualification code: *Certificate IV in Dental Assisting*) is a nationally recognised vocational education credential, designed to prepare students for roles supporting dentists and dental specialists. This diploma covers essential clinical and administrative skills, enabling graduates to support dental procedures, manage patient care, and perform various administrative duties.
Core Modules of the Certificate IV in Dental Assisting
- Dental Practice Procedures
- Radiography Techniques
- Infection Control and Sterilisation
- Patient Management and Care
- Administrative and Business Skills in Dental Practice
- Legal and Ethical Aspects of Dental Assisting

Practical Tips for Enrolling and Excelling in the Program
1. Choose Accredited and Reputable Training Providers
Start by researching registered training organisations (RTOs) that offer the Certificate IV in Dental Assisting. Verify their accreditation status, student support services, and industry connections to ensure quality education.
2. Develop Strong Time Management Skills
The program combines theoretical coursework with practical placements. Balancing study, work, and personal commitments is essential to succeed.
3. gain Hands-On Experience Through Practical Placement
Utilise internship or placement opportunities to gain real-world experience, build confidence, and establish professional connections within the dental industry.
